Maasai elder woman, wearing traditional beadwork jewellery. The Maasai use beaded jewellery as an everyday adornment to represent wealth, beauty, strength, warriorhood, marital status, age-sect, children-borne, social status, and other important cultural elements. They are also presented at ceremonies, at rites of passage, and to visitors as a sign of gratitude and respect.Ali Zoeb is a Tanzanian photographer with an eye exploring the emotionality of people to capturing the traditional old-world portraits. Ali’s photographic flairs bring together diverse streams to co-exist and flow at the same time, driven by the issues he feels strongly for. Photographing the people and communitys of Tanzania, such as the Maasai and the Hadzabe, Ali wants to reveal that the value of such pictures doesn’t come so much from the physical image itself, but more from his subject’s back-story and message.In the third edition of the Wise Wall Project, we are collaborating with the culturally rich and one of the oldest communitys in the world, the Maasai community, in Arusha, Tanzania, in partnership with Vikram Solar Ltd., Vijana Inspiring Foundation, Lions Club of Dar es Salaam and Arusha City, and Google Arts and Culture. Along with building an on-ground community centre and museum for the community, we are bringing an exclusive insight into the life, lifestyle and learnings from this inspiring community.The Wise Wall Project is an initiative of Project FUEL that aims to document, design and strengthen the wisdom of rural communities and marginalised villages using art and community outreach programmes. The arts lead the way to raise support for the challenges these villages face today like migration, quality education and access to basic amenities like water and roads.

A Photographer of Stories: The Life and Vision of Ali Zoeb

Ali Zoeb is a Tanzanian photographer whose work transcends the simple act of image-making, evolving into a profound exploration of human emotion and cultural preservation. Born in Tanzania, his artistic journey began not with formal training but with an innate curiosity—a desire to understand and document the lives unfolding around him. He isn’t merely capturing faces; he's revealing narratives, histories etched onto skin, and the enduring spirit of communities often overlooked by the wider world. Zoeb’s photographic style is deeply rooted in a documentary tradition, yet infused with a sensitivity that elevates his work beyond mere reportage. His focus centers on the people and communities of Tanzania, particularly those like the Maasai and Hadzabe, whose traditions are both ancient and increasingly vulnerable to the pressures of modernity.

Capturing Tradition: The Essence of Maasai Portraits

Zoeb’s most recognized work revolves around his evocative portraits of the Maasai people. These aren't staged or idealized representations; they are intimate glimpses into individual lives, marked by resilience, dignity, and a deep connection to their ancestral heritage. He masterfully employs sepia tones and careful attention to detail—the intricate beadwork adorning necks and wrists, the weathered lines on faces that speak of generations past—to create images that feel both timeless and deeply personal. The power of his portraits lies in his ability to convey not just *what* these individuals look like, but *who* they are, their stories radiating from the canvas. He understands that the true value of these photographs isn’t solely in the physical image itself, but in the backstories and messages embedded within each subject's gaze. Zoeb doesn’t simply photograph; he collaborates with his subjects, fostering a relationship built on respect and mutual understanding.

The Wise Wall Project: Art as Community Empowerment

Zoeb’s commitment extends beyond individual portraits to encompass broader community engagement through the “Wise Wall Project.” This initiative, spearheaded by Project FUEL, aims to document, design, and strengthen the wisdom of rural communities in Tanzania using art and outreach programs. In its third edition, Zoeb partnered with the Maasai community in Arusha, collaborating with organizations like Vikram Solar Ltd., Vijana Inspiring Foundation, Lions Club of Dar es Salaam and Arusha City, and Google Arts and Culture to build a community center and museum. This project is a testament to his belief that art can be a catalyst for positive change—a means of raising awareness about the challenges faced by marginalized communities, such as migration and access to education, while simultaneously celebrating their rich cultural heritage. The Wise Wall Project isn’t just about creating beautiful images; it's about empowering communities to preserve their traditions and share their stories with the world.
